I am a bilingual Spanish-English educator and trainer with extensive experience designing curricula and delivering student-centered instruction across K-12, university, corporate, and online settings. I hold an M.A. in Teaching Spanish and an M.A. in Management with a focus on conflict resolution, and I integrate linguistics, pedagogy, and cultural competence into practical coursework and assessments.
Throughout my career I have founded and managed a language institute, developed industry-focused teaching materials (including a construction-industry Spanish manual), published a Business Spanish beginner eBook, and authored a hospitality Spanish capstone unit. I have consistently used formative and summative assessment, ACTFL-aligned communicative approaches, and technology to boost student engagement and measurable performance.
I have tutored over 1,360 hours online with a five-star rating, trained corporate teams in Business English and customer-service communication, and supervised instructors and program operations. I seek roles where I can apply curriculum design, teacher training, and cross-cultural communication to improve learning outcomes and support organizational goals.
